EVENT OVERVIEW
Most of our events and programs are open to Chamber Members and friends/non-members. We average 70-100 business leaders attending most events and 100-150 at our special programs. The Hanover Chamber of Commerce offers a variety of regular programs listed below.

September - May A 9-month interactive certificate program to strengthen and encourage local leaders. Sessions focus on leadership philosophy, self-awareness, effective communication, delegation and teamwork, visioning, efficient networking, and community and civic engagement. The Leadership Hanover class learns from and is mentored by an accomplished and diverse faculty of established leaders from across Hanover and the RVA region. | April The Sheriff’s Annual Awards Ceremony is followed by a dinner reception open to all deputies, their families and our chamber community in recognition of our thanks for the tremendous service they provide.
